🥘 Ingredients

11 items
  • 1 lb lump crab meat
  • 0.5 cup breadcrumbs
  • 0.25 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 tbsp Dijon mustard
  • 2 tbsp parsley
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p Old Bay seasoning
  • 2 tsp lemon juice
  • 0.5 tsp salt
  • 0.25 tsp black pepper
  • 2 tbsp vegetable oil

📝 Instructions

6 steps
1

In a large mixing bowl, gently combine the lump crab meat, breadcrumbs,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, chopped parsley, egg, Old Bay seasoning, lemon juice, salt, and black pepper. Be careful not to break up the crab too much as you mix.

2

Once combined, use your hands to form the mixture into 8 even-sized patties (about 2-3 inches in diameter). Place them on a plate or tray, cover, and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to help them firm up.

3

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Once the oil is hot, carefully place the crab cakes in the skillet, making sure not to overcrowd the pan.

4

Cook the crab cakes for 4-5 minutes on each side, or until they are golden brown and heated through.

5

Transfer the cooked crab cakes to a plate lined with paper towels to drain any excess oil.

6

Serve immediately with your choice of tartar sauce, remoulade, or a squeeze of fresh lemon juice. Pair with a crisp green salad or roasted vegetables for a complete meal.
